9th annual assembly of PMF held
By our correspondents
November 27, 2015
KARACHI: The 9th annual assembly of Pakistan Microfinance Forum (PMF) was held on Thursday, hosting experts and operational chiefs who spoke with the stakeholders of the industry and discussed the sector's future strategy, a statement said.
The central theme of this year's forum was "Time to move forward from Regulations to Actions". The purpose was to generate innovative ideas, which can help bring necessary changes in the economic situation of Pakistan and empower the human capital, it said.
The annual conference aims at identifying solutions to the challenges faced by the microfinance industry and its stakeholders regarding growth and expansion.
Experts also evaluate the social performance and impact of this essential sector through research tools and the necessary realignments in the policy structure.
Speaking on the occasion, Ghalib Nishtar, president of Khushhalibank said, “World over, half to two-thirds of all businesses are MSME’s and in many regions this proportion is much higher.”
"MSME’s are capable of creating jobs with least amount of capital and in dispersed locations which makes them attractive to policymakers."
